Cedar Hedge Lake is a medium-sized lake with a very sandy bottom.[1] It is known for its large island, Cedar Hedge Island in the southern area of the lake. The lake is completely within Green Lake Township, Grand Traverse County, Michigan.
The northern branch of the Little Betsie River flows out of the lake and into nearby Green Lake. Then, water flows into the Betsie River and out to Lake Michigan
